Centrale solaire des Terres Rouges
Centrale solaire des Terres Rouges is a power station in Faugères, Arrondissement of Béziers, Occitanie. Centrale solaire des Terres Rouges is situated nearby to the climbing site Arbre et aventure 34, as well as near the volcano Le Courbezou.| Tap on a place to explore it |
